How to Shorten the Construction Timeline for Steel Retail Shops

1. Start with Detailed Planning and Early Coordination
A well-structured construction plan is the cornerstone of any time-efficient project. Steel retail shop projects should begin with a clear scope, defined milestones, and a realistic schedule that factors in permitting, adquisición de materiales, and workforce availability. Early coordination among architects, ingenieros, contratistas, and suppliers is critical to avoid delays caused by miscommunication or incomplete designs. Utilizing project management software can enhance collaboration and ensure every stakeholder is aligned on deadlines and responsibilities.
By investing time upfront in detailed planning, developers can foresee potential bottlenecks and implement preventive measures. Por ejemplo, aligning structural engineers and steel fabricators early allows for more accurate scheduling of steel delivery, minimizing idle time on the construction site.
2. Optimize the Design for Speed and Efficiency
Steel retail shops benefit from modular and pre-engineered designs. Pre-engineered steel buildings (PEBs) are particularly advantageous because they reduce on-site fabrication requirements. Architects and engineers should prioritize designs that simplify connections, standardize component sizes, and reduce custom fabrication needs. This approach minimizes assembly time and can significantly shorten construction schedules.
Además, designing for constructability—considering how materials will be transported, lifted, and installed—prevents on-site complications that can prolong construction. Using Building Information Modeling (BIM) can further enhance coordination, allowing teams to identify clashes, optimize material usage, and plan installation sequences with precision.
